Factors to consider while buying a tablet under 20,000

There are several factors that you must consider while buying a budget tablet that costs under 20,000. While factors like a vibrant display and a powerful processor are important, the list doesn't end there. You must also look for accessories that support your particular use-case. So, here are all the factors that you must factor in before zeroing down on a particular tablet model:

- First is the display. Look for a tablet with a full HD display with a resolution of at least 1920 x 1200 pixels along with, a 90Hz screen refresh rate and at least 300 nits of peak brightness for vibrant colours and a comfortable viewing experience.

- Size matters as much as the screen quality. A tablet sized between 8-9 inches is suitable for reading and entertainment, while a screen greater than 10 inches in size is good for productivity-related tasks and multi-tasking.

- Processors are important but having a RAM of at least 4GB is important for a tablet to run smoothly without lag. Also look for models with at least 128GB of storage space for storing apps and files.

- On the software front, ensure the tablet you pick runs at least Android 14 or 15 to stay updated with the latest security features.

- Having a big battery is important. Typically, a battery capacity ranging between 7,000mAh to 9,000mAh is ideal for a tablet to last for around 8-10 hours. But if that's not the case, look for fast charging support, which will help you juice up the device quickly even if it discharges fast.

- Also look for the set of connectivity options that suit your use-case. Wi-Fi variants are cheaper, but if you need internet on the go, look for LTE/4G models.

- Lastly, if you plan to use this tablet for productivity, look for features like stylus support.

The OnePlus Pad Lite is a multimedia-focused tablet with a sleek and minimal design that is easy to carry. It features a large 11-inch display with a 90Hz refresh rate and 500 nits brightness, delivering a smooth and vibrant viewing experience for streaming and reading. It is powered by the MediaTek Helio G100 processor that is paired with 8GB RAM and 128GB of storage space. This combination handles everyday tasks efficiently. A standout feature is its massive 9340mAh battery with 33W fast charging, which ensures long usage cycles. It runs Android 15-based OxygenOS 15, which offers features like Open Canvas multitasking and seamless cross-device syncing. It has received 4.3 out of 5 ratings on Amazon.

The Redmi Pad 2 is a feature-packed budget tablet that blends sleek design with practical performance. It sports a slim metal body and a large 11-inch 2.5K display with a 90Hz refresh rate that delivers sharp visuals. It is powered by the MediaTek Helio G100 Ultra processor that is paired with 6GB of RAM and 128GB of storage space. This combination is designed to handle everyday tasks, streaming, and light productivity with ease. A standout highlight is its massive 9000mAh battery, which ensures all-day usage. Another interesting feature of this tablet is the support for Dolby Atmos-backed quad speakers. Beyond these features it gets HyperOS 2, which offers a well-rounded multimedia experience. It has received 4.2 out of 5 ratings on Amazon.

The Lenovo Tab is a sleek, budget-friendly tablet designed for everyday entertainment and productivity. It features a slim metal design with an 10.1-inch Full HD display and a smooth 60Hz refresh rate, making it ideal for streaming and reading. It is powered by the MediaTek Helio G85 processor with 4GB RAM and 128GB of storage. This combination delivers reliable performance during daily tasks. It comes with a quad-speaker setup with Dolby Atmos that enhances the multimedia experience, while the 5100mAh battery ensures long usage hours. It runs Android 14, it also supports accessories like a stylus for note-taking. This tablet has received 4.4 out of 5 ratings on Amazon.

The Acer Iconia Tab iM11 is a productivity-focused tablet with a premium slim metal design and a large 11.45-inch 2.2K IPS display that delivers sharp visuals and good brightness. It is powered by the MediaTek Helio G99 processor that is paired with up to 8GB of RAM and 256GB of storage space, which handles multitasking, streaming, and light gaming smoothly. A standout feature is its value-packed bundle, including a keyboard, stylus, and flip cover, making it ready for work and study out of the box. It runs Android 14 operating system and it is backed by a 7400mAh battery, which offers a complete multimedia experience. It has received 3.8 out of 5 stars on Amazon.

The HONOR Pad X9 comes with a premium metal unibody design and slim profile. It features a large 11.5-inch 2K display with a 120Hz screen refresh rate, which makes it ideal for streaming and reading. It is pow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 685 processor that is paired with 7GB of Turbo RAM and 128GB of storage space that deliver a smooth performance. It comes with a six-speaker surround audio system that offers an immersive experience. It is backed by a 7,250mAh battery and runs Android 13 based MagicOS. It has received 4.3 out of 5 ratings on Amazon.

Look for tablets with a large display (10–11 inches), long battery life, and stylus support. These are ideal for note-taking, online classes, and multitasking.
You can play casual and moderately demanding games, but don’t expect flagship-level performance. Look for processors like MediaTek Helio G99 or Snapdragon 6-series for better gaming.
Wi-Fi tablets are cheaper and suitable for home use, while 4G LTE tablets offer on-the-go connectivity without needing a hotspot.
At least 4GB RAM is recommended, but 6GB or 8GB RAM ensures smoother multitasking and better long-term performance.
With proper usage, most tablets in this range last 3–4 years. Opting for higher RAM and a trusted brand can improve longevity.
